How many tons of fill-dirt do I need per cubic yard for estimating projects in Coconino County?

Loose fill-dirt in Coconino County typically weighs about 1.2 to 1.6 tons per cubic yard depending on moisture and soil type; high-moisture clay will be heavier. For planning use a conservative estimate of about 1.4 tons per cubic yard, and increase for compaction or if your contractor specifies compacted weights.

How do Coconino County weather patterns (monsoon rains, winter snow) affect fill-dirt performance?

Monsoon rains can wash loose fill-dirt and cause sediment transport, while winter freeze-thaw can lead to settling and uneven surfaces. Proper compaction, erosion controls (silt fence, berms), and good drainage are important to prevent washouts and settling after wet seasons. Store stockpiles covered and away from drainage paths to reduce erosion risk.

Do local contractors in Coconino County recommend compaction and geotextile when installing fill-dirt?

Yes — contractors commonly recommend compacting fill-dirt in lifts for any structural work (driveway bases, building pads) to reduce settling. Geotextile or separation fabric is often used over soft or sandy subgrades to stabilize the fill and prevent mixing with native soils, especially on slopes or near washes. For critical projects, get a site-specific recommendation from a local civil engineer or contractor.

Are permits or county regulations required for adding fill-dirt to residential property in Coconino County?

Permitting depends on scope and location; minor landscaping may not need a permit, but grading, changing drainage, adding significant fill, or work in flood-prone areas often requires Coconino County permits or approval. Check with Coconino County Planning and Zoning or your town office and review any HOA rules before placing large volumes of fill. When in doubt, contact the county to confirm requirements before ordering.

How does fill-dirt compare to crushed rock or engineered fill for driveways and erosion control in Coconino County?

Fill-dirt is suitable for raising grade and general backfill but is not an ideal wearing surface for driveways because it compacts poorly and erodes in heavy rains. Crushed rock or engineered base materials provide better drainage, load-bearing capacity, and long-term performance for driveways and erosion control. For slopes or wash areas, engineered fill, riprap, or graded rock are better choices to resist monsoon runoff and winter freeze-thaw effects.

What maintenance should homeowners expect for areas covered with fill-dirt in Coconino County?

Areas covered with loose fill-dirt will need regular attention after storms — expect raking, regrading, and occasional top-up after heavy monsoon rains or spring runoff. If fill-dirt is used as a compacted base with a gravel or rock surface, maintenance drops to annual regrading and adding material as needed. Plan inspections after major storms and address drainage issues promptly to avoid washouts.

How should I estimate quantities and prepare my site for a fill-dirt delivery in Coconino County?

Measure the area length, width, and depth in feet and convert to cubic yards (length x width x depth / 27) before applying the tons-per-cubic-yard factor; use about 1.4 tons per cubic yard as a working estimate. Prepare a clear drop zone with adequate truck access, note gate widths and overhead wires, and flag soft spots or drainage channels for the driver. Include site notes at checkout and contact our team if you need help with measurement or access planning.
